What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Deductions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Deductions Analyst, you need a strong background in accounting, finance, or business administration, often sup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, proficiency in Excel, and experience with deduction management software are typ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ills are crucial for resolving discrepancies and collaborating with internal and external st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ate financial records, minimize revenue loss, and support efficient resolution of deduction-related issues.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in deductions ro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als working in deductions often face the challenge of managing large volumes of claim disputes, short payments, and chargebacks from customers. Resolving these requires strong attention to detail, effective communication with both internal teams (like sales and accounts receivable) and external customers, and sometimes, negotiation skills. Building a systematic approach to documentation and leveraging automation tools can help streamline the deduction resolution process, reduce errors, and improve recovery rates.

What are deductions specialists?

Deductions specialists are professionals responsible for managing and resolving deductions made from customer payments in a company's accounts receivable. They investigate the reasons behind deductions, such as pricing discrepancies, damaged goods, or promotional allowances, and work with customers, sales teams, and internal departments to resolve issues. Their goal is to recover lost revenue and ensure accurate financial records by reconciling accounts and maintaining thorough documentation.

Deductions Analyst
We are seeking a Deductions Analyst with 2-4 years of experience in a CPG environment to support deduction management and resolution activities. This role will be responsible for researching, analyzing, and resolving customer deductions while partnering cross-functionally with accounting, sales, and customer service teams.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Investigate and resolve customer deductions and chargebacks
  • Manage deductions related to pricing discrepancies, promotions/trade spend, returns, damages, shortages, and compliance penalties
  • Validate supporting documentation and ensure accurate account reconciliation
  • Collaborate with internal teams to identify root causes and reduce recurring deductions
  • Maintain accurate records and reporting within internal systems

Qualifications:
  • 2-4 years of deductions or accounts receivable experience within a CPG environment
  • Experience handling trade promotions, pricing claims, and retailer compliance deductions
  • Hands-on experience with HighRadius and Microsoft Dynamics 365
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ment
